@-webkit-keyframes opacity { 0% { opacity: 1; } 100% { opacity: 0; } } @-moz-keyframes opacity { 0% { opacity: 1; } 100% { opacity: 0; } } .server-box { margin:0px 0px 15px 0px; padding:25px 30px 30px 30px; } .server-box.checking { color: #8a6d3b; background-color: #fcf8e3; border-left: 5px solid #faebcc; } .server-box.is-up { color: #3c763d; background-color: #dff0d8; border-left: 5px solid #d6e9c6; } .server-box.is-down { color: #a94442; background-color: #f2dede; border-left: 5px solid #ebccd1; } .server-box-status p { font-size: 16px; margin: 0px; } .server-loading span { -webkit-animation-name: opacity; -webkit-animation-duration: 1s; -webkit-animation-iteration-count: infinite; -moz-animation-name: opacity; -moz-animation-duration: 1s; -moz-animation-iteration-count: infinite; } .server-loading span:nth-child(2) { -webkit-animation-delay: 100ms; -moz-animation-delay: 100ms; } .server-loading span:nth-child(3) { -webkit-animation-delay: 300ms; -moz-animation-delay: 300ms; }